Studying the Application of Strategic Management Components in Isfahan Public Universities
This research aimed at investigating the application of strategic management components in public universities in Isfahan, and the research method was descriptive survey study. The population consisted of 340 managers, out of which 181 managers were selected by stratified random sampling in proportion to the size, and 151 were selected by strategic management researcher-made questionnaire based on the theory of Hill and Jones (2007), in five components goal & mission determination, environmental analysis, strategy formulation, strategy implementation, and strategy evaluation responded with 33 items.Validity of the questionnaire was confirmed by content and construct validity and using Cronbach’s Alpha the reliability of the questionnaire was estimated 0.83. Data analysis was performed at two levels of descriptive statistics (frequency distribution, percentage, mean and standard deviation) and inferential statistics level (One-sample t-Test, Independent-Samples t-Test, Hotteling t2, one-way ANOVA and Tukey post-hoc test). The results showed that the application rate of the components, except the goal & mission determination component, was below average. The results of Hotelling's t2 showed that the components of application were not the same, so that the most attention was paid to the goal & mission determination component and the least attention to the environmental analysis and strategy formulation components. (P <0.05).
